Subject: Re: [PATCH] Alchemy: get rid of allow_au1k_wait
Date: Thu, 27 Aug 2009 12:08:19 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20090827110819.GA29984@linux-mips.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1250957367-14389-1-git-send-email-manuel.lauss@gmail.com>

On Sat, Aug 22, 2009 at 06:09:27PM +0200, Manuel Lauss wrote:

> Eliminate the 'allow_au1k_wait' variable.  MIPS kernel installs the
> Alchemy-specific wait code before timer initialization;  if the C0
> timer must be used for timekeeping the wait function is set to NULL
> which means no wait implementation is available.
> 
> As a sideeffect, the 'wait instruction available' output in
> /proc/cpuinfo now correctly indicates whether 'wait' is usable.
> 
> Run-tested on DB1200.
